Mail boxes robbed. Tiller and Mc Dowell sentenced
Prentice Tiller and Edward C. McDowell alias Grant pleaded guilty to mail box robberies in Cincinnati. They were sentenced by U. S. Judge Thompson to five and three years at hard labor in the penitentiary. Widespread rifling across cities alleged. McDowell re captured after escape in Chicago. witnesses from Omaha Hastings Dayton and Toledo. Tiller previously tied to a $100,000 express robbery near St. Louis.

Stock Panic Does Not Halt General Business Says Bradstreet
Bradstreet notes the New York Stock Exchange violent price fall appears a stock panic not touching general industries. No wheat or staple supplies will be harmed. Grain speculation cooled as investors focus on stocks. Trade outlook improves modestly due to better crop prospects from timely rains after planting.

Circus rider killed in wild west show stunt
Miss Theresa Russell of Denver an equestrienne with a Wild West show fatally injured at Vine Counes Indiana while attempting a hand to horse leap. Her foot caught in a stirrup dragged around the ring until cowboys halted the running horses and killed one animal with a pitchfork. She died from internal and external injuries.

Widow Fends Off Burglars in New Jersey Milestone Stand
Mrs. Ella Karcher a 60 year old widow on the Morris turnpike near Elizabeth N J confronted two burglars after they gained entry She threw one from a window chased the other and forced a surrender Then she rode with them to Senator Keans home to await police The burglars named Lawrence Downing and Patrick Dowing

Cannibalism Aboard Wrecked Angloa Bark Angola Survivors
Empress of India reports the wreck of the British bark Angola off the Philippines. Two survivors C Hjalman Johansen and Miguel Marticorena tell of mutiny and cannibalism after the crew was slaughtered and eaten amid wreckage on a raft before reaching Boubi Soubi.

Death in Experiment by St Louis Chemist
A St Louis chemist identified as J Sultan, about 30, died at City Hospital after self administering a sedative he was testing to create sleep inducing compounds. He worked for a local drug company and hoped to lead production of the new formulation as a prize for success.

Wreck of Colusa Found Off Queen Charlotte Island
The wreck of the American ship Colusa has been located in a rocky cove on the southwest side of Renuwell Sound near Queen Charlotte Island. The vessel appears stripped by its crew and abandoned at sea with no signs of campfires or human occupation nearby.

Big Robbery Plot Found In Kansas City Freight Theft
Police uncover a conspiracy to steal Burlington freight cars. James Magruder and W L Riding, conductor and brakeman on the Kansas City to Brookfield Mo. freight, are arrested. Goods recovered include ladies hoses corsets patent leather shoes and butter. Riding admits involvement. Two other railway workers are jailed but not charged. Magruder and Riding reside in Brookfield.

Man Sacrifices Life to Save Friend at Indianapolis Boiler
William Phelps of Richmond, Kentucky dies while guiding James Stansbury of Indianapolis to safety in a Cercaline mills boiler incident. The two men were cleaning a high boiler when steam released. Stansbury escaped with minor burns after Phelps urged him to go first.

Gypsy Prince Robbed in St Paul Tent Heist
Leonard Wells reported to St Paul police that his tent was entered and $3460.10 stolen. Of the amount $460.10 was in gold and silver, the rest in bank certificates from several states, mainly Ohio, with several people implicated in the carefully planned robbery.

Mrs McKinley Sinks Into Illness in San Francisco Flight
The President halted his West tour as Mrs. McKinley fell gravely ill in San Francisco. A special train carried the couple along with officials to reach Washington at the earliest possible moment. Doctors expressed cautious optimism but warned the illness could prove serious.
Mrs McKinley’s Illness Deepens During Western Journey
Reports from the presidential party describe Mrs McKinley’s condition worsening after a finger felon became infected and a dysentery attack. Dr. Rixey treated the felon, while Mr Cortelyou announced that the public should be informed of the true situation as the President remained at her bedside through the San Francisco stopover.
